Four sisters, originally
from Goderich, are each
$250,000 ., richer after
winning a Emnillion dollar
Provincial -Lottery prize
:Sunday, June 24.
Ada Harvey, • 54, of
-Brampton; Margaret.•
Bennett, 43, of Hunt-
sville; Marion Patterson,
43, of Bolton; and
Dorothy Nobes, 52, of St.
Catharines, all daughters
of the late David• Pitblado
of Goderich, will bank
their winnings until they
decide what to do with
them.
Mrs. Harvey, who was
maried the day before
the 'c, aw, said she was
x.numb•,) after her sister
called "\to say they • had
won. ' a four sisters
have sh:., ed Provincial
tickets sin the lottery
began. They have shared
,a $1,000 and a $50 prize in
past draws.
"We've worked hard all
' our -lives and we're glad
wegot it (the $1
million)," she said. "It
makes it a lot easier on
us."
She said Mrs. Pat-
terson and Mrs. Bennett,
whp are twins, plan to
continue working: - Mrs.
Patterson is a •nurse .in
• ,services at Bram.pton''s.
Peel Merriorial^`'Hospital
and is the .daughter -in-
' law of Mrs. Grace. Pat-
terson of Goderich. Mrs.
Bennett works for the
- Huntsville Forester
newspaper. Mrs. Nobes
doesn't work.

The reported gas
shortages in the United
States could -have a two-
sided effect on tourism in
. southwestern Ontario,
says the Southwestern
Ontario. Travel
Association (SWOTA).
1V1any residents -may be
reluctant to leave the -
area whereas U.S.
residents 'living close to
the border may choose a -
holiday in southwestern
Ontario where gas . is
plentiful. -_.
SWOTA hgs setirfout a
list of things to see and do
which will be of interest
tothese potential '
traveller's. On that list is
Goderich's Festivalof the
Arts from July 12 to 14.
Remember to treat'
visitors to- Goderich
royally, Tourist dollars
are . important to ` our
community.

A longer strawberry
season will be the
luscious reward of a plant -
breeding program at the--
Uni-ve=r-sity• of Guelph.
Prof. W. D. Evans,
Department of Hor-
ticultural Science,.•is
developing • commercial
strawberry hybrids to
meet_" changing- market
conditions and production
1d B -its..
patterns.
"We're looking . for
strawberries adaptable
to mechanical -harvesting
and hulling," says ;Prof.
Evans. "Firm, good -
quality, berries are,
needed for the fresh trade
and for processing. We
want to extend the
picking season in Ontario
to • co-mpete against
California strawberries
and to meet export
demand."
